In recent years, robotics technology has been widely used, which shows its importance in the field of science and technology. Robot control is also one of the core parts of robot development. Using Java language to realize robot control can achieve fast robot control and provide strong support for the further development of robots.

Java is a high-level language that has become a widely used programming language due to its good cross-platform nature, efficiency and security. It also provides good support in implementing robot control.

First of all, you need to understand the principles and components of robot control. Robot control generally includes robot movement control and arm control. Robot movement includes translation and rotation; arm control mainly includes arm extension, rotation and grabbing. These controls require the person in charge to program the robot and transmit the control instructions to the robot. Java language can realize this instruction transmission process by writing control programs.

Secondly, understand the hardware interface programming in Java programming. Hardware interface programming refers to programming and controlling the interface between hardware devices and computers. Hardware interface programming requires certain basic knowledge of hardware, such as serial port, parallel port, network port, etc.

In using Java to implement robot control, you need to master two important concepts: programmable controller (PLC) and communication protocol. A PLC is a fully functional, programmable electronic device that can be used to control a robot's analog and digital input/output signals. Communication protocol refers to the protocol through which the robot and the computer interact. In Java programming, commonly used communication protocols include ModBus and CAN.

Finally, you need to master the robot library in Java software. The robot library is a part of the software that simplifies the programming process of robot control and provides basic program components. Commonly used robot libraries in Java include RosJava and Robot Operating System (ROS).

Through the above introduction, it can be seen that Java has the necessary conditions to realize robot control. Below, we use a simple robot control example to explain in detail how to use Java to implement robot control.

We assume that there is a robot with the following movement requirements: translation 30cm, rotation 45 degrees, arm extension 50cm, arm rotation 45 degrees, grabbing items. Next, we control the robot to complete the above actions through a Java program.

1. First, you need to connect the robot hardware and computer to establish serial communication.

2. Write Java programs, including robot control module, communication protocol module and PLC control module.

3. In the robot control module, use the robot library to control the robot.

4. In the communication protocol module, the ModBus communication protocol is used for interaction between the robot and the computer.

5. In the PLC control module, use instruction transmission to control the robot. Among them, the control instructions in the program are sent to the robot PLC through the hardware interface, and the status of the robot PLC is monitored through the program.

The above is the simple implementation process of robot control. Of course, in the actual robot control process, the specific instructions and control modules are relatively complex and need to be appropriately adjusted for different robot types and needs. But overall, the excellent performance and good cross-platform nature of the Java language provide an efficient and convenient way to realize robot control.
